Mopeds appeared at the dawn of mechanical engineering, when the vast majority of people preferred to use horse-drawn carriages over mechanical vehicles. In those days, mopeds attracted consumers, first of all, because of their cheapness compared to cars that very wealthy people could afford to buy. Then, mopeds and scooters quickly spread among the working-class population in Europe, who quickly appreciated the advantages and benefits over cycling.
A moped is essentially a motorized bicycle. It is distinguished from motorcycles and scooters by an engine with a volume of no more than 50 cm³ and a maximum speed not exceeding 50 km /h. Due to the fact that a moped moves much slower than a car or motorcycle, it must occupy the right lane on the road, like a bicycle. Over time, mopeds significantly improve their driving performance.
Intensive technical development of mopeds began during the Second World War, when the military became interested in them. After the war, the center of moped building settled in Japan, Japanese mopeds were bought in China, in the United States and Europe, and soon their own production began to develop in many countries. However, scooters and mopeds from Japan are still regarded as a benchmark for technical development and quality.
